Saskatchewan is extending an order limiting the co-mingling of poultry into June, due to an ongoing outbreak of highly pathogenic avian influenza (HPAI).
The order, enacted by the province’s Chief Veterinary Officer, prohibits the movement of birds to shows, auctions, agricultural fairs and any other events where they would be brought together from multiple locations.
The order was set to expire on May 14, but will continue until at least June 14.
